Popular Posts

Monday, May 14, 2018

Missouri Lawmakers Approve Defunding Abortion Providers as Planned Parenthood’s ‘Handmaids’ Protest

The “handmaids” of Planned Parenthood strode through the Missouri Statehouse this week as the state’s lawmakers passed a budget prohibiting the direction of funds to facilities associated with abortion providers.

Dressed as women from Hulu’s The Handmaid’s Tale, Margaret Atwood’s 1985 dystopian feminist novel about a totalitarian theocracy that forces women to procreate, the protesters are now a familiar sight in government buildings when Planned Parenthood’s taxpayer funding is in jeopardy:



  1. What a bunch of maroons!

  2. Witches at black mass. Pure satanic evil. Lie deceive death, that how his followers roll.


Note: Only a member of this blog may post a comment.